Transaction 0fb84f4fe0446272f3b82511040f1dee737609a6fe355e68aeb695923ec25e44

block
51f9f0148651ed386ae89f46e2629c2cb57e58aa2f1bc699010304bc90d2e06b

1 Input

1379 Outputs